Based on your preference, you can’t go wrong with either Nashville or Charleston, and if you live in their downtown area (which is not far from the airport) you’ll be fine even without a car. Just pick your spots and walk or Uber! Btw, if you’re going to Argentina, I don’t know what all do you have on your list, but Ushuaia, Iguazu and Mendoza/Uco Valley are a must along with BA. Internal flights are super cheap. Use the Arbolitos (money exchangers who deliver cash to your doorstep) for getting cash as their unofficial (Blue Market) exchange rate is almost twice that of the official one. Ok. Just got back 2 days ago from Lisbon. Flew in and out of EWR. Do carry-on only. I’m guessing you’re flying TAP. Immigration takes time in Lisbon depending on the flight landing time, but relatively faster for US citizens. They will bus you from the plane to the gate when you land. You then go through immigration check. You will mostly be bussed even from the gate to the flight for the one to Seville. Also flew from LIS to Seville. That’s an easy flight. 35 mins flight time. Once you’re out of Lisbon immigration, you’re good. EWR was a long security line 2 weeks ago, so you’ll need time for that I’m guessing. Generally in Terminal B. Hope that helps!
